NEWTON, M — During FY 2023 budget deliberations on Monday, the Massachusetts House of Representatives inserted an amendment that would direct UMass Amherst to consider a life sciences center for the Mount Ida Campus in Newton, reported State House News. Consolidated Amendment "A" was adopted 156-0 and would require the university to study the "the feasibility of establishing a Massachusetts school of health sciences education and center for health care workforce innovation" at the Mount Ida Campus in Newton. The amendment, which adds an additional $7.3 million in spending to the $49.6 billion budget bill, deals with education, local aid, social services, veterans' services, and soldiers' homes proposals. It also includes $500,000 for a new Genocide Education Trust Fund line item.
